Output 598f9522739341b2160dd45854d8032b18029b5d9049831c37591a89d47ae2b3:0

value
248249
script pubkey
OP_HASH160 OP_PUSHBYTES_20 def790bf7847111adfab11b84f5b24f46e5a392c OP_EQUAL
address
3N1xWH2c7HRZwSbVpavoXqUVdq31HyWhJ9
transaction
598f9522739341b2160dd45854d8032b18029b5d9049831c37591a89d47ae2b3
confirmations
330368
spent
true